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ale serves 50 students in grades 9-12.
Minority enrollment is 98%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Florida state average of 64% (majority Hispanic and Black).

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the graduation rate of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ale?
The graduation rate of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ale is 50%, which is lower than the Florida state average of 89%.
How many students attend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ale?
50 students attend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
90% of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ale students are Black, 8% of students are Hispanic, and 2% of students are White.
What grades does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ale offer ?
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ale offers enrollment in grades 9-12
What school district is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ale part of?
Sunfire High School Of Ft Lauderdale is part of Broward School District.
